Leclerc lays bare Ferrari's current Achilles' heel

©Ferrari Michael Delaney 27/03/2025 at 08:3327/03/2025 at 08:57 In the wake of Ferrari’s challenging start to its 2025 F1 season, Charles Leclerc has addressed the team’s concerns and pinpointed specific areas where the Scuderia’s SF-25 needs improvement. Just two races into its campaign, the Italian outfit finds itself languishing in fifth place in F1’s Constructors’ Championship, a staggering 61 points behind leader McLaren. This gap is attributed not only to operational missteps, such as the double disqualification in China, but also to a noticeable shortfall in the car's overall speed.
